College Football Rankings: TCU, Boise State and Alabama

Puppet MasterOct 22, 2010

In the small world of setting odds for wagering, the name of Kenny White is not unknown to high rollers. 

A respected insider in Las Vegas, White has expanded his influence by creating a ratings program that evaluates the relative strengths and weaknesses of college football teams.

Known as The Las Vegas Rankings, the system of Mr. White identifies the top 30 teams in the nation on a weekly basis.

With the season more than half over, a concentration on the Top 15 teams in the rankings should provide us with the most reasonable and viable candidates for the BCS Title Game. 

In the following pages we will journey into the mysterious world of inside knowledge concerning the top football teams in the nation.

Teams Ranked No. 11 Through No. 15

Looking into the abyss of teams in this selected group, followers should recognize they are given very little consideration for an invitation to the national championship game.

A cold glass of water to the face of many who feel undefeated LSU is on track for national success this season.

Rank:     Team:               Last Week:          Relative Strength Rating:

No. 11:      Virginia Tech      (20)                      113.6

No. 12:      Stanford             (10)                      113.5

No. 13:      Florida State       (9)                       113.1

No. 14:      LSU                   (13)                      112.8

No. 15:      Wisconsin          (20)                      112.7

If the season plays out according to White's ranking system, Virginia Tech has the edge on Florida State in the ACC while LSU and Wisconsin can only hope for a major bowl invitation.

Stanford appears to have earned the respect of knowledgeable viewers.

Rankings For No. 6 To No.10

The position of these five teams seems to indicate each is a dark horse for the BCS Title game but very much in the race for major bowl consideration.

Rank:     Team:               Last Week:          Relative Strength Rating:

No. 6:      Ohio State          (2)                        115.7

No. 7:      Auburn               (13)                      114.5

No. 8:      Nebraska            (6)                       114.2

No. 9: (Tie) Utah                (16)                      113.9 

No. 9: (Tie) Iowa                 (15)                     113.9

The Top 5 Teams In The Nation

The top five teams make a strong argument for being the group where we find the eventual  BCS Title game participants.

Oklahoma, No. 1 in the BCS Poll this week, is only ranked No. 5 in the Vegas ratings.

Oregon, No. 1 in the AP Poll this week, is ranked only No. 4 using the same system.

Note that Alabama was No. 2 last week but was jumped by unbeaten Boise State this week. This action demonstrates the inaccuracy of believing SEC teams cannot be jumped by non-BCS Conference teams under unbiased conditions.

To further drive home that point, TCU of the Mountain West Conference remained No. 1 in the nation.

Rank:     Team:            Last Week:           Relative Strength Rating:

No. 5:      Oklahoma          (8)                      115.8

No. 4:      Oregon              (5)                      117.1

No. 3:      Alabama            (2)                      117.4

No. 2:      Boise State        (4)                      117.9

No. 1:      TCU                   (1)                      118.1

Where Do We Go From Here With The BCS Bowl Games?

If we take the rankings to its natural conclusion we would see Boise State and TCU clash in the BCS Title Game.

These two titans have played in Bowl games against each other in the past two seasons, each game fiercely contested and decided late.

There is no reason to think a clash between the two behemoths would not have the potential of being the one of the greatest championship games of all time.

The remainder of the BCS Bowls, following the specified rankings, would unfold in this manner:

Sugar: Alabama (SEC Champion) vs. at-large Nebraska

Orange: Va Tech (ACC Champion) vs. at-large Auburn

Rose: Oregon (PAC10 Champion) vs. Ohio State (Big10 Champion)

Fiesta: Oklahoma (Big 12 Champion) vs.  Big East Champion ?

All of these contests would be potentially exciting, attract media attention, and produce contests worthy of a stadium sell out.

The Las Vegas Rankings just might be on to something.
